Larue County had won six straight on the road, but on Monday they bumped their record up to 27-6 to make it seven. They never let the Marion County Knights get on the board and left with a 2-0 victory. That's the second time they've managed to beat them this season, as they also won 4-1 back in March.
The result came thanks to Heidi Tipton's shutout, as she gave up just five hits and racked up nine Ks.
On the hitting side, Molly Abbott was incredible, going 1-for-2 with one home run and two RBI.
As for Marion County, their defeat ended a three-game streak of wins at home and dropped them to 13-10-1. Having soared to a lofty 16 runs in the game before, their shutout was a dramatic turnaround.
On Marion County's side, Gracyn Mattingly sp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ered just two earned runs on seven hits and racked up six Ks.
At the plate, Marion County sa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Kendra Gaddie, who went 2-for-3 with one stolen base. Gaddie is on a roll when it comes to stolen bases, as she's now snagged at least one in each of the last three games she's played.
